Publication number: 20120222893Abstract: A solder composition includes about 4% to about 25% by weight tin, about 0.1% to about 8% by weight antimony, about 0.03% to about 4% by weight copper, about 0.03% to about 4% by weight nickel, about 66% to about 90% by weight indium, and about 0.5% to about 9% by weight silver. The composition can further include about 0.2% to about 6% by weight zinc, and, independently, about 0.01% to about 0.3% by weight germanium. The composition can be used to solder an electrical connector to an electrical contact surface on a glass component.Type: ApplicationFiled: February 1, 2012Publication date: September 6, 2012Applicant: Antaya Technologies CorporationInventors: Jennie S. Publication number: 20120222908Abstract: A snow bike system includes a motorcycle converted for use in the snow with a rear suspension and belt track system. The belt track is relatively very wide and driven by a front wheel sprocket through a jackshaft. Matching shocks and struts in the rear suspension independently equalize the pressure applied to the ground. The rear strut is a sliding extension type that causes the front of the sliders to kick up when fully compressed during acceleration or climbing uphill. Increased weight on the rear track is shifted forward to keep the front ski down. The jackshaft provides both disc braking and moves the motorcycle engine drive power outboard to accommodate the wider belt track. A tubular subframe and tunnel rigidly mounts to the motorcycle's original rear swing arm pivots and shock mounts.Type: ApplicationFiled: March 1, 2011Publication date: September 6, 2012Inventor: Allen Mangum

Publication number: 20120222917Abstract: A movement of an elevator cage is detected by an elevator control on the basis of signals of a rotary encoder, coupled with a rotational movement of the drive motor or the drive pulley. Before movement of the cage begins, a movement plot in the form of a trip/speed profile is calculated for travel of the elevator cage from an instantaneous elevator cage position to a destination stopping point position. An anticipated slip between the drive pulley and a support means is included in the calculation of the trip/speed profile, and during the travel of the elevator cage a rotational movement of the drive motor and thus of the drive pulley is controlled by the elevator control in dependence on the calculated trip/speed profile and on signals of the rotary encoder.Type: ApplicationFiled: September 2, 2011Publication date: September 6, 2012Applicant: Inventio AGInventors: Valerio Villa, Yong Qi Cui

Publication number: 20120222927Abstract: A method and apparatus are disclosed for cooling damping fluid in a vehicle suspension damper unit. A damping unit includes a piston mounted in a fluid cylinder. A bypass fluid circuit having an integrated cooling assembly disposed therein is fluidly coupled to the fluid cylinder at axial locations that, at least at one point in the piston stroke, are located on opposite sides of the piston. The cooling assembly may include a cylinder having cooling fins thermally coupled to an exterior surface of the cylinder and made of a thermally conductive material. The bypass channel may include a check valve that permits fluid flow in only one direction through the bypass channel. The check valve may be remotely operated, either manually or automatically by an electronic controller. A vehicle suspension system may implement one or more damper units throughout the vehicle, controlled separately or collectively, automatically or manually.Type: ApplicationFiled: March 2, 2012Publication date: September 6, 2012Inventor: John Marking
